Aditya Roy Kapur has carved a niche for himself in the industry ever since his debut in the film London Dreams. He was recently seen in The Night Manager, for which he received widespread acclaim. Now, he is all set to appear in the romantic drama Metro... In Dino. The movie also stars Sara Ali Khan. Recently, Aditya revealed that this film is something he has never done before in his career.

Aditya Roy Kapur opened up about doing diverse projects, including both intense and lighter roles. He said, "This seems like something I haven’t done before as an actor. It’s a very interesting idiosyncratic character that seems to dance to the beat of his own drum and gave me the opportunity to really take chances and have fun with it. It’s nice to be able to do something light, the last thing that I did was The Night Manager which was very fulfilling but also intense, so it’s nice to go from something intense to something lighter. In this way, you are doing different things. I think it’s going to be an interesting and fun character and it’s a genre that I enjoy."

Talking about his journey as an actor, Aditya added, “I enjoyed the first Metro, so doing this one is something I am looking forward to. For me, my journey as an actor is just about trying to do things that I haven’t done before. It’s always exciting, gets you the slight amount of fear, which can be a very good driving force when you are going into the unknown, and I find that that’s when you are the most alive and you can do your best work. When you are just at the edge of kind of something, you don’t know whether it’s good or not."

The upcoming movie Metro In Dino is being directed by Anurag Basu. Recently, the makers unveiled the trailer, which offers glimpses into four couples and their love stories. Aditya's character is shown visiting different places in search of true love. He and Sara are seen navigating a modern relationship surrounded by commitment phobia.

Produced by Bhushan Kumar, Krishan Kumar, Anurag Basu, and Taani Basu, the movie also stars Konkona Sen Sharma and Pankaj Tripathi, Anupam Kher and Neena Gupta, and Ali Fazal and Fatima Sana Shaikh. After the trailer launch, fans are excited to watch it in theatres. The film is slated for release on July 4, 2025.
